Job description

Overview

RN - Emergency Dept

Full Time Evenings

3 x 12 hour shifts per week

11 am - 11pm

*Sign on Bonus up to $10,000 available

Piedmont Eastside Medical Center- Emergency Dept

Snellville, GA

We are looking for positive, self-motivated, engaged and excited for growth individuals to join our team

38 bed Emergency Department that sees on average 160 patients a day that present with various acuities.

We are a primary Stroke and Stemi receiving facility that is able to intervene and administer thrombolytics.

Two helicopter pads on campus for utilization

We have 5 PODs in our department, depending on acuity, is where the patient will be assigned

Behavioral Health Pod

We have Charge nurses, ED Flow Coordinators, Paramedics, ED Techs, PCTs, Mental Health Technicians and Unit Secretaries who work in close collaboration with the ED Providers to provide exceptional care

All staff members must have a BLS to work in this unit

Responsibilities
RESPONSIBLE FOR:

The staff nurse provides nursing care to patients from birth through the lifecycle utilizing nursing processes to assess, plan, implement, and evaluate the care for patients. He/she functions within the framework of the policies and procedures of the organization and demonstrates professional growth and accountability. The staff nurse is responsible for maintaining standards of practice, coordinating patient care activities of all assigned staff in the provision of quality nursing care.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:
  1. Performs patient assessments to include collection of data regarding the patient’s physical, psychosocial and health history.
  2. Appropriately evaluates the developmental age of the patient when performing assessments, treatments and patient/family education.
  3. Organizes patient data into the formulation of a plan of care; identifies additional information needed and makes care decisions based on identified needs. Identifies expected patient outcomes.
  4. Carries out plan of care to achieve desired patient outcomes.
  5. Provides patient care that is specific to the setting, identified needs and plan; ensures that the care provided is appropriate to the severity of the disease, condition, impairment or disability.
  6. Oversees activities of ancillary and support team members.
  7. Identifies teaching opportunities and provides the resources necessary for achieving the educational goals of the patients.
  8. Communications issues/concerns to the Charge Nurse, Clinical Manager and/or physician as appropriate.
  9. Documents patient care and concerns in the patient record.
